Subject: Re: [PATCH] MAINTAINERS: adjust file entry in ARM/LPC32XX SOC SUPPORT

Hi Lukas,

On Thu, Apr 11, 2024 at 07:02:57AM +0200, Lukas Bulwahn wrote:
> Commit 20c9819ccd9e ("dt-bindings: i2c: nxp,pnx-i2c: Convert to dtschema")
> converts i2c-pnx.txt to nxp,pnx-i2c.yaml, but misses to adjust the file
> entry in ARM/LPC32XX SOC SUPPORT.
> 
> Hence, ./scripts/get_maintainer.pl --self-test=patterns complains about a
> broken reference.
> 
> Adjust the file entry in ARM/LPC32XX SOC SUPPORT after this conversion.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Lukas Bulwahn <lukas.bulwahn@...hat.com>
